MONTIRIUS offers a unique blend of Clairette, Roussanne, and Grenache White grapes. While the exact origin is unknown, these varietals come together in an intriguing wine profile that hints at rich textures and aromatic complexity reminiscent of Rhône white wines. With notes of pear, honey, herbs, and floral tones, this wine showcases a broad texture capable of aging well. Expect a palate with moderate acidity and a savory finish, potentially developing nutty and herbal nuances over time. Perfect for pairing with a variety of dishes including roast chicken, lobster, scallops, pork, cream sauces, root vegetables, mushrooms, and alpine cheeses.
